West Hamilton AFC player Kevin Bryers will never forget the support he has received from the staff at the Beatson Cancer Unit which he now plans to raise funds for with a Charity game – and would welcome the support of Scottish senior clubs to support the idea.
Kevin made contact with myself and asked “Is there any way you guys can help (with publicity ) that would be great.”
“I was diagnosed last year with Cancer and the Beatson has been amazing. It was a tough fight.”
“I’m currently in remission at the moment and have to attend the Beatson for the next 5 years, but holding this event is my way of giving something back, plus you meet loads of people who are going through the same thing too, and they rely on funding. This is why I’m trying to make the event as big as I can.”
“West Hamilton are involved as they gave me the chance to get back into football again plus I’m planning to play in goals 1 half with Team Beatson, and the other half with West Hamilton.”
“We have Hamilton Accies on board, and also the Old Firm.”
“Venue has still to be decided. I am in talks with a number of clubs and they are on going.”
